Precision and Consistency in Hallmarking
Hallmarking has long been a trusted method for validating the purity of precious metals, especially gold. Traditionally, this process involved manual stamping techniques, which often led to inconsistencies, potential damage to intricate designs, and slower operations. With the introduction of laser hallmarking, the process has become far more accurate and consistent. The laser beam precisely engraves detailed hallmark symbols, including BIS logos, karat values, and jeweller identification marks, without compromising the structural integrity or aesthetic appeal of the ornament.
This high level of accuracy ensures that each piece of jewellery is marked uniformly, eliminating discrepancies and errors common in manual methods. The deep, clear, and permanent markings made by the machine are resistant to wear and tampering, boosting consumer confidence and meeting strict regulatory standards.

Compliance with Industry Standards
Governments and regulatory bodies around the world, including the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S), have made hallmarking mandatory to ensure consumer protection. Laser hallmarking machines are designed to comply with these legal requirements, offering precision marking in line with BIS standards.
By adopting laser hallmarking, jewellers not only ensure their products meet legal obligations but also gain a competitive edge in the market. Consumers increasingly prefer hallmarked jewellery for its assurance of quality and investment value, making the technology an indispensable asset for any jewellery business aiming for growth and credibility.
Technology Driving Transparency
Transparency in gold quality is crucial for establishing trust between jewellers and consumers. Laser hallmarking machines contribute to this by providing a clear, tamper-proof marking that is easy to verify. In addition, many modern machines offer advanced features such as barcode or QR code engraving, which can link to a digital certificate or product history.
This blend of physical and digital authentication strengthens traceability and opens doors to blockchain-based certification systems in the future. As a result, customers can enjoy a seamless, transparent buying experience, and jewellers can confidently stand behind the authenticity of their offerings.
